Show HN: RunVeto – A Simple Kill Switch for Autonomous AI Agents

Hey HN,

I’m a software engineer with 5 years of experience, and I’ve been building autonomous agents recently using LangChain. I noticed that we are giving these agents too much "autonomy" without enough "governance".

The specific problem I faced was Agent Sprawl/Recursion. A test bot got stuck in a recursive loop and almost ran up a significant OpenAI bill before I noticed and killed the process manually.

So, I’m building RunVeto.xyz as a minimal governance layer—a control plane for agent guardrails. It sits between your agent and the LLM API, framework-agnostic, and integrates with one line of code.

What I’m planning to implement:

Hard-Cap Budgeting: Set strict token/cost limits to kill any task before it breaks the bank.

Global 'Veto' Button: Pause or terminate any active agent process from a central dashboard.

PII Shield: Automatic scrubbing of sensitive data (PII) before it hits the LLM.

'Chain-of-Thought' Audit: Real-time visibility into agent planning logs.

I'm currently pre-MVP and using this landing page to validate the core features and find "founding developers" to guide the roadmap.

I'd love to hear this community's critique. Have you encountered "recursive loops" in your own agent workflows? What’s your biggest operational nightmare with agents?
